POSITION SUMMARY : The Quality Manager role combines strategic quality leadership with hands‑on oversight of our ISO‑compliant Quality Management System.

You will lead internal and external audits, drive corrective and preventive actions, oversee supplier and customer quality performance, and ensure product acceptance through rigorous documentation, first article inspections, and continuous improvement initiatives. Success in this role requires a detail‑oriented, team‑focused leader who excels in a fast‑paced precision manufacturing environment and is comfortable balancing managerial responsibilities with technical, data‑driven quality work.

ESSENTIAL FUNCTONS: A qualified individual with a disability must be able to perform the essential functions of the position, with or without reasonable accommodation. Lead, develop, and maintain the ISO‑compliant quality system. Plan, conduct, and support internal, external, supplier, and customer audits. Oversee corrective actions (CAR/PAR), drive timely closure, and report results. Manage customer and supplier quality evaluations and feedback loops.

Support continuous improvement (Lean, Six Sigma, TPS). Provide training, mentoring, and cross-departmental quality guidance. Lead quality documentation processes and ensure compliance with standards. Participate in strategic planning for quality initiatives and operational improvements. Perform incoming, in-process, and final inspections using advanced metrology tools. Interpret, analyze, and validate optical and mechanical blueprints/specifications.

Conduct First Article Inspections (FAIs), inspection data packet reviews, and source inspections. Maintain production and quality records in accordance with internal quality policies. Utilize precision measurement equipment: profilometers, interferometers, OGP systems, CMMs, and other optical testing instruments. Serve as a primary interface with suppliers and customers for quality issues and root cause investigations.

Work with Engineering and Manufacturing to ensure quality is built into products and processes from the outset. Ensure that products meet all applicable quality and documentation requirements (ISO, GMP, SOPs, SPIs). Perform other related duties as assigned.
